Web2 okt. 2013 · Ultimately no ONE stripper may work 100% of the time on every single type of paint, but you can get good results with a few proven winners. One thing with all of them - put the model in a plastic tub with a lid, cover it completely with what you will use to strip it, and put the lid on. Let it sit a good 24 hours.

Strip and ... flying colors coloring bookWeb17 mrt. 2012 · Lacquers are tough paints and will be hard to remove without melting the plastic itself. You might try some Tamiya (plastic safe) lacquer thinner or Gunze Mr. Color thinner. Both are synthetic thinners that are relatively safe on plastic. I have found oven cleaner, super clean, etc. will not do much with lacquer at all. flying colors connell wahttp://www.modelcarsmag.com/forums/topic/112653-paint-stripper-insights-on-lacquer-removal/ greenlight international durastar flatbed
